When can I expect my order?
Our leather products are made ‘to order’. January through November you can expect your order to ship from our studio in CA within 3-6 working days. During December it may take 7-10 days depending on the number of orders in house. Order early to avoid the holiday crush!
UPS delivers to the east coast within 5 working days, the Midwest within 4-5 working days, north and southwest in 3-4 working days and the west coast within 1-2 working days. We offer all UPS shipping methods including: ground, 3-day select, 2nd day and red label or overnight shipping.
Do you give exclusives?
We put every new customer address through a zip code search. When researching new customer locations relative to existing accounts we consider the following: distance, store type, longevity of the account, product type ordered, purchasing activity, finance charge history or history of non-payment.
We don’t offer exclusives, however we do all we can to protect accounts purchasing $800-1000 or more annually. If you haven’t ordered in more than one year I’m sure you understand that we can’t afford to turn away a new customer in your location. We run a zip coast search on all new customers to determine if we are already selling to a store in that location. We use Mapquest to research the distance between locations. We also consider the size of the town or city to determine what the market can bear. If we have any questions, usually we do, we contact the existing account buyer to discuss the situation and negotiate if it’s appropriate: ie if one account doesn’t sell pewter and the new account only wants our barrettes, etc.

Why Can't I Choose my Own Color or Older Images No Longer Shown Online or in Our Catalog?
A brief history of Oberon policy: In our early days we held inventory on our leather products and shipped them in assortment of 12 each only. We then allowed customers to choose whatever image and color combination they chose. We offered so many choices that inventory became untenable. In the mid 1990’s we began to make all our leather products ‘to order’ and began to track what we were selling, not only products but color and image combinations.
Within two years, we began to see that the majority of our top twenty images sold in one color 90% of the time. This knowledge, combined with the constant comments of retailers that our line was too complex and difficult an ordering process, lead us in 2005 to assign the most popular color to each image.
For those customers that find this change dissatisfactory, we do offer you the chance to order images in non-catalog colors for a $5 service charge per item.
Why are there products for sale on your retail site that don’t appear on your wholesale site?
Oberon Design is now making covers for a number of electronic products. These are product covers that cannot accommodate both wholesale and retail pricing structures and still sell competitively. The plethora of constantly changing devices (not to mention upgrades) and the difficulty of the corner strap fit on our electronic covers lead us to the conclusion that our return policy would not accommodate wholesale sales of these items.
